Najważniejsze trendy w projektowaniu stron internetowych w 2024 roku
W 2024 roku projektowanie stron internetowych przechodzi prawdziwą rewolucję. Minimalizm i prostota stają się coraz bardziej popularne, co widać na przykładzie takich stron jak Apple czy Google. Interaktywne animacje i mikrointerakcje dodają dynamiki i angażują użytkowników, co przekłada się na lepsze doświadczenia użytkownika. Responsywność i dostosowanie do urządzeń mobilnych to już standard, a ciemny motyw zyskuje na popularności, oferując nowoczesny wygląd i oszczędność energii na urządzeniach mobilnych.
Korzyści z wdrożenia tych trendów są nie do przecenienia. Lepsza użyteczność i szybsze ładowanie stron przekładają się na wyższą konwersję i zadowolenie użytkowników. Eksperci podkreślają, że dostosowanie strony do najnowszych trendów może znacząco wpłynąć na pozycjonowanie w wyszukiwarkach. Warto więc zainwestować w nowoczesne technologie i innowacyjne rozwiązania, aby nie tylko przyciągnąć, ale i zatrzymać użytkowników na dłużej.
Jak sztuczna inteligencja zmienia sposób tworzenia stron internetowych
Sztuczna inteligencja rewolucjonizuje proces projektowania i tworzenia stron internetowych, wprowadzając automatyzację i personalizację na niespotykaną dotąd skalę. Dzięki narzędziom takim jak Adobe Sensei czy Wix ADI, projektanci mogą teraz tworzyć bardziej intuicyjne i spersonalizowane doświadczenia użytkowników. AI analizuje dane użytkowników, co pozwala na dynamiczne dostosowywanie treści i układów stron, co z kolei zwiększa zaangażowanie i konwersje.
Jednym z przykładów skutecznego wykorzystania AI w web designie jest firma The Grid, która stworzyła platformę do automatycznego projektowania stron internetowych. Dzięki zaawansowanym algorytmom, The Grid potrafi samodzielnie dobierać kolory, czcionki i układy, tworząc estetyczne i funkcjonalne strony bez potrzeby ingerencji człowieka. Korzyści z zastosowania AI obejmują oszczędność czasu, redukcję kosztów oraz zwiększenie efektywności. Jednakże, istnieją również wyzwania, takie jak potrzeba ciągłego aktualizowania algorytmów i potencjalne problemy z bezpieczeństwem danych.
Responsywność i mobilność: Klucz do sukcesu w nowoczesnym web designie
W dzisiejszym świecie, gdzie urządzenia mobilne dominują, responsywność i mobilność stron internetowych to absolutna konieczność. Strony, które nie dostosowują się do różnych rozdzielczości ekranów, tracą użytkowników i generują wyższy wskaźnik odrzuceń. Projektowanie responsywne polega na tworzeniu stron, które automatycznie dostosowują się do wielkości ekranu, zapewniając optymalne doświadczenie użytkownika niezależnie od urządzenia.
Do tworzenia responsywnych stron warto wykorzystać narzędzia takie jak Bootstrap czy CSS Grid, które ułatwiają implementację elastycznych układów. Przykłady stron, które są wzorem responsywności, to chociażby Apple czy Airbnb. Statystyki pokazują, że ponad 50% ruchu internetowego pochodzi z urządzeń mobilnych, co podkreśla znaczenie mobilności w projektowaniu stron.
Nie można zapominać o testowaniu responsywności na różnych urządzeniach i przeglądarkach, aby upewnić się, że strona działa poprawnie w każdych warunkach. Google Mobile-Friendly Test to jedno z narzędzi, które może pomóc w ocenie, czy strona spełnia wymagania mobilności. Responsywność i mobilność to nie tylko trend, ale standard, który definiuje sukces w nowoczesnym web designie.
Bezpieczeństwo stron internetowych: Nowe technologie i najlepsze praktyki
W dzisiejszym dynamicznym świecie internetu, bezpieczeństwo stron internetowych jest priorytetem. Nowoczesne technologie, takie jak SSL/TLS, firewalle aplikacyjne (WAF) oraz systemy wykrywania i zapobiegania włamaniom (IDS/IPS), odgrywają kluczową rolę w ochronie danych użytkowników. SSL/TLS zapewnia szyfrowanie danych przesyłanych między serwerem a klientem, co jest niezbędne dla zachowania prywatności. Firewalle aplikacyjne monitorują i filtrują ruch sieciowy, chroniąc przed atakami typu SQL injection czy cross-site scripting (XSS).
Najlepsze praktyki w zakresie bezpieczeństwa stron internetowych obejmują regularne aktualizacje oprogramowania, stosowanie silnych haseł oraz wdrażanie dwuetapowej weryfikacji (2FA). Narzędzia takie jak Sucuri czy Cloudflare oferują kompleksowe rozwiązania do monitorowania i zabezpieczania stron.
Optymalizacja wydajności stron internetowych: Narzędzia i techniki
Optymalizacja wydajności stron internetowych jest nie tylko istotna dla użytkowników, ale również ma ogromne znaczenie dla SEO. Szybko ładujące się strony przyciągają więcej odwiedzających, co przekłada się na lepsze wyniki w wyszukiwarkach. Google i inne wyszukiwarki faworyzują strony, które oferują szybkie i płynne doświadczenia użytkownika.
Istnieje wiele narzędzi, które mogą pomóc w analizie i poprawie wydajności stron. Google PageSpeed Insights, GTmetrix oraz Pingdom to tylko niektóre z popularnych opcji. Te narzędzia dostarczają szczegółowych raportów na temat różnych aspektów wydajności strony, takich jak czas ładowania, rozmiar plików oraz liczba zapytań HTTP. Dzięki nim można zidentyfikować obszary wymagające poprawy i wdrożyć odpowiednie techniki optymalizacyjne.
Jedną z efektywnych technik jest lazy loading, która polega na ładowaniu obrazów i innych zasobów tylko wtedy, gdy są one potrzebne. Dzięki temu zmniejsza się czas ładowania strony i zużycie zasobów. Inne techniki to minifikacja plików CSS i JavaScript, kompresja obrazów oraz używanie CDN (Content Delivery Network). Poniżej znajduje się tabela porównująca różne narzędzia optymalizacyjne:
Narzędzie
|
Funkcje
|
Plusy
|
Minusy
|
---|---|---|---|
Google PageSpeed Insights
|
Analiza wydajności, rekomendacje
|
Łatwość użycia, darmowe
|
Ograniczone funkcje zaawansowane
|
GTmetrix
|
Szczegółowe raporty, testy z różnych lokalizacji
|
Zaawansowane funkcje, darmowe i płatne plany
|
Interfejs może być przytłaczający dla początkujących
|
Pingdom
|
Monitorowanie wydajności, testy szybkości
|
Łatwość użycia, dokładne raporty
|
Ograniczone funkcje w darmowej wersji
|
Interaktywne elementy i animacje: Jak zwiększyć zaangażowanie użytkowników
Wprowadzenie interaktywnych elementów i animacji na stronach internetowych może znacząco poprawić doświadczenie użytkownika (UX). Dzięki nim, strona staje się bardziej atrakcyjna i angażująca, co może prowadzić do dłuższego czasu spędzonego na stronie oraz wyższych wskaźników konwersji. Narzędzia takie jak JavaScript, CSS oraz biblioteki jak GSAP czy Anime.js umożliwiają tworzenie zaawansowanych animacji i interakcji, które przyciągają uwagę użytkowników.
Przykłady stron, które skutecznie wykorzystują animacje, to między innymi serwisy takie jak Apple czy Airbnb. Te strony wykorzystują płynne przejścia, mikrointerakcje oraz dynamiczne elementy, które nie tylko przyciągają wzrok, ale również poprawiają nawigację i ogólną użyteczność strony. Aby animacje były efektywne, ważne jest, aby były one optymalizowane pod kątem wydajności. Unikaj nadmiernego obciążania strony, stosując techniki takie jak lazy loading oraz minimalizowanie liczby animowanych elementów jednocześnie.
Wskazówki dotyczące optymalizacji animacji obejmują również korzystanie z narzędzi takich jak Chrome DevTools do monitorowania wydajności oraz testowanie strony na różnych urządzeniach i przeglądarkach. Dzięki temu można upewnić się, że animacje działają płynnie i nie wpływają negatywnie na czas ładowania strony. Pamiętaj, że dobrze zaprojektowane i zoptymalizowane animacje mogą znacząco zwiększyć zaangażowanie użytkowników i poprawić ogólne wrażenia z korzystania z Twojej strony internetowej.
Najczęściej zadawane pytania
Jakie są najważniejsze czynniki wpływające na SEO strony internetowej?
Najważniejsze czynniki wpływające na SEO to jakość treści, szybkość ładowania strony, responsywność, struktura URL, optymalizacja obrazów, użycie odpowiednich słów kluczowych oraz linkowanie wewnętrzne i zewnętrzne.
Czy warto inwestować w Progressive Web Apps (PWA)?
Tak, warto inwestować w PWA, ponieważ oferują one lepszą wydajność, możliwość działania offline, szybkie ładowanie oraz lepsze doświadczenie użytkownika, co może prowadzić do zwiększenia zaangażowania i konwersji.
Jakie są najlepsze praktyki w zakresie dostępności stron internetowych?
Najlepsze praktyki obejmują używanie odpowiednich znaczników HTML, zapewnienie tekstów alternatywnych dla obrazów, tworzenie czytelnych i kontrastowych treści, umożliwienie nawigacji za pomocą klawiatury oraz testowanie strony pod kątem dostępności za pomocą narzędzi takich jak WAVE czy Lighthouse.
Jakie są korzyści z używania systemów zarządzania treścią (CMS) w tworzeniu stron internetowych?
CMS-y, takie jak WordPress, Joomla, ICEberg CMS 5 ułatwiają zarządzanie treścią, umożliwiają łatwe aktualizacje, oferują szeroki wybór wtyczek i motywów, wspierają SEO oraz pozwalają na współpracę wielu użytkowników nad jedną stroną.
Jakie są najczęstsze błędy popełniane podczas projektowania stron internetowych?
Najczęstsze błędy to brak responsywności, zbyt długie czasy ładowania, nieczytelna nawigacja, nadmiar animacji i efektów, brak optymalizacji SEO, niewystarczające zabezpieczenia oraz ignorowanie potrzeb użytkowników z niepełnosprawnościami.